The Japan Aluminium Association (JAA) released June statistics for rolled aluminum +81 3 6703 1198
products on 29 July. Flat-rolled product shipment volume was up 10.3% y-y. This marks
the first time that single-month shipment volume has risen by more than 10% since
November 2021. Shipments of automotive materials were weak, falling 7%, but other
products performed well. Shipment volumes of can materials were up 14%. Shipment
volumes of products other than can materials and automotive materials were also up 14%,
marking a fourth straight month of double-digit growth. Exports were up 12%, and
shipments for SPE applications also rose. Shipment volumes for applications other than
can materials and automotive materials reached 49,000t in June, the highest for a single
month in the four years since June 2022 (Figures1–10).
Flat-rolled products (2): Apr–Jun shipments up 6% y-y
Shipment volumes of flat-rolled products were up 6% y-y in Apr–Jun, with a 2% increase
for can materials, a 6% decline for automotive materials, and a 12% increase for other
